1992 Tel Aviv Open

The 1992 Tel Aviv Open was a men's tennis tournament played on hard courts that was part of the World Series of the 1992 ATP Tour. It was the 13th edition of the tournament and was played at the Israel Tennis Centers at Ramat HaSharon near Tel Aviv in Israel from October 12 through October 19, 1992. Jeff Tarango won the singles title.

Finals

Singles

Jeff Tarango defeated Stéphane Simian 4–6, 6–3, 6–4

  • It was Tarango's 2nd title of the year and the 2nd of his career.

Doubles

Mike Bauer / João Cunha Silva defeated Mark Koevermans / Tobias Svantesson 6–3, 6–4

  • It was Bauer's only title of the year and the 9th of his career. It was Cunha Silva's only title of the year and the 1st of his career.
